Artifishal is a movie by Patagonia films playing on Wednesday, August 14, 6:30 pm to 8:30 pm. The film is about people, rivers, and the fight for the future of wild fish, and the environment that supports them. It explores wild salmon's slide toward extinction, and the threats posed by fish hatcheries and fish farms. A short film, Motherfish, by Rusty Grim, will start the evening.
